Market Up – Will It Last?

The Dow had an up 400 day, mostly on the news that the Fed was going to inject $200 billion of liquidity into the market.   This gave hope to many investors that the worse might be behind us and that it was time to get back into the market.

I kept my money on the sidelines.  I’m not sure how this Fed action at all solves the fundamental problems that caused the market to tank in the last few months.  We are heading into a period where we need to pay for the excesses of the last few years.  We can delay it, and that is what the Fed seems to be trying to accomplish, but in the end, someone is going to have to pay up.

The market reacted to relatively weak news, and this stimulated others to jump in not to miss the boat.  But when the smoke clears people are going to realize that the fundamentals just aren’t there.
